Cape Town - Delft, Harare, Mfuleni and Gugulethu police stations reported the most sexual offences per station in the Western Cape between January 2021 and March 2022.

In a written reply to the ANC’s Gladys Bakubaku-Vos, Western Cape Community Safety MEC Reagan Allen said the department was in the process of monitoring the level of compliance of SAPS specialised units dealing with sexual offence cases, namely the Family Violence, Child Protection and Sexual Offences (FCS) units.

The latest crime stats, released in early June, showed an increase in murder and rape cases between January and March, 2022.

Murder increased by 22.2% from 4 976 in the same period last year to 6 083 in 2022. Rape also shot up by 13.7% to 10 818 during the first three months of this year.

The total number of sexual offences reports per station between January 2021 and March 2022 are made up of rape, sexual assault, contact sexual offences, and attempt sexual offences.

The breakdown of the 10 stations with the most reported sexual offences per station were:

  • Delft, 420
  • Harare, 329
  • Mfuleni, 265
  • Gugulethu, 256
  • Nyanga, 244
  • Kraaifontein, 240
  • Mitchells Plain, 212
  • Khayelitsha, 204
  • Knysna, 195
  • Thembalethu, 163

“The department’s focus is on monitoring SAPS with the Domestic Violence Act, and in doing so, priority is given to monitoring police stations that fall in the top 50 police stations in terms of domestic violence incidents reported,” Allen said.
